15,000-acre reservoir near Cambridge. the uppermost Hells Canyon reservoir on the Snake (ID/OR line), a legendary crappie, catfish and smallmouth lake. The lake tops out around 300 ft. In spring, smallmouth bass run shallow here, mostly 3 to 12 ft. By summer they slide out to 10 to 30 ft, and by winter most fish are in 20 to 45 ft. In spring, crappie run shallow here, mostly 2 to 8 ft. By summer they slide out to 10 to 25 ft, and by winter most fish are in 15 to 35 ft.
